Possibilities of using a digital elevation model in large-scale soil mapping (Perm district of the Perm region)

The article presents the results of large-scale soil mapping based on a digital elevation model. The aim of the research is to study the possibility of using the DEM classification by the Based Landform Classification method in large-scale soil mapping. The research area covers an area of 150 hectares, which is located in the Perm rayon of the Perm region. The initial cartographic base represents the result of calculating relief elements using the Based Landform Classification method in the SAGA geographic information system. ALOS 30 was used as a digital elevation model. During the field survey, the relationship of soil types with Landform coverage was established, which made it possible to extrapolate the data to some areas. As a result of comparison with a large-scale soil map made by the traditional method, it was found that the number of soil EPA increased by 5 times. The best interconnection of relief elements is observed for sod-gley soils and sod-brown soils.
